NVIDIA GRID™ Visual Computing Appliance Launched For Windows, Linux or Mac

NVIDIA, the GPU leader has launched industry's first NVIDIA GRID™ Visual Computing Appliance for Windows, Linux and Mac operating systems. The system is capable of running complex & graphics intensive applications from Adobe Systems Incorporated, Autodesk and Dassault Systèmes and is able to transmit the output over the network so that it can be viewed on client machines. NVIDIA says that this remote GPU acceleration enables users to have the same graphics processing capabilities without having a dedicated machine at their end.

The system empowers small and medium sized businesses with limited IT infrastructure to create virtual graphics processing machines at a click of a button. CEO of NVIDIA, Mr. Jen-Hsun Huang says that the NVIDIA GRID VCA is industry first appliance that provides convenient and on-demand video processing.

The system indeed is a quite powerful inside. It's got 16 NVIDIA GPUs and NVIDIA GRID VGX software which together deliver NVIDIA Quadro class graphics performance to 16 concurrent users.

Those interested in buying the system will have to wait until its US launch in May at price starting at $24,900 for 8 GPU configuration. The annual license cost of the software will be $2400.
